2015-12-22 00:53:59

by kernel test robot

[permalink] [raw]
Subject: [lkp] [ipv4, ipv6] c5e8d791ca: BUG: unable to handle kernel

FYI, we noticed the below changes on

https://github.com/0day-ci/linux Geliang-Tang/Bluetooth-use-list_for_each_entry/20151218-234306
commit c5e8d791cacac62eeec48e00a1a14a6a350670f4 ("ipv4, ipv6: use list_for_each_entry*")


[ 6.848404] IPv6: Attempt to override permanent protocol 33
[ 6.850925] kworker/u2:1 (109) used greatest stack depth: 7240 bytes left
[ 6.850925] kworker/u2:1 (109) used greatest stack depth: 7240 bytes left
[ 6.880428] BUG: unable to handle kernel
[ 6.880428] BUG: unable to handle kernel NULL pointer dereferenceNULL pointer dereference at (null)
at (null)
[ 6.882213] IP:
[ 6.882213] IP: [<ca1779b8>] __list_del_entry+0x88/0x230
[<ca1779b8>] __list_del_entry+0x88/0x230
[ 6.883565] *pdpt = 0000000000000000
[ 6.883565] *pdpt = 0000000000000000 *pde = f000ff53f000ff53 *pde = f000ff53f000ff53

[ 6.885082] Oops: 0000 [#1]
[ 6.885082] Oops: 0000 [#1] SMP SMP

[ 6.885926] Modules linked in:
[ 6.885926] Modules linked in:

[ 6.886781] CPU: 0 PID: 1 Comm: swapper/0 Not tainted 4.4.0-rc3-00302-gc5e8d79 #1
[ 6.886781] CPU: 0 PID: 1 Comm: swapper/0 Not tainted 4.4.0-rc3-00302-gc5e8d79 #1
[ 6.888380] Hardware name: QEMU Standard PC (i440FX + PIIX, 1996), BIOS Debian-1.8.2-1 04/01/2014
[ 6.888380] Hardware name: QEMU Standard PC (i440FX + PIIX, 1996), BIOS Debian-1.8.2-1 04/01/2014
[ 6.890387] task: c005a000 ti: c005c000 task.ti: c005c000
[ 6.890387] task: c005a000 ti: c005c000 task.ti: c005c000
[ 6.891774] EIP: 0060:[<ca1779b8>] EFLAGS: 00010246 CPU: 0
[ 6.891774] EIP: 0060:[<ca1779b8>] EFLAGS: 00010246 CPU: 0
[ 6.895311] EIP is at __list_del_entry+0x88/0x230
[ 6.895311] EIP is at __list_del_entry+0x88/0x230
[ 6.896639] EAX: 00000000 EBX: cab7cd7c ECX: 00000000 EDX: 00000000
[ 6.896639] EAX: 00000000 EBX: cab7cd7c ECX: 00000000 EDX: 00000000
[ 6.899728] ESI: 00000000 EDI: 00000000 EBP: c005deec ESP: c005dec4
[ 6.899728] ESI: 00000000 EDI: 00000000 EBP: c005deec ESP: c005dec4
[ 6.903932] DS: 007b ES: 007b FS: 00d8 GS: 0000 SS: 0068
[ 6.903932] DS: 007b ES: 007b FS: 00d8 GS: 0000 SS: 0068
[ 6.905123] CR0: 80050033 CR2: 00000000 CR3: 0ade1000 CR4: 000406b0
[ 6.905123] CR0: 80050033 CR2: 00000000 CR3: 0ade1000 CR4: 000406b0
[ 6.909725] Stack:
[ 6.909725] Stack:
[ 6.910254] cab7a080
[ 6.910254] cab7a080 d5a87f88 d5a87f88 c005deec c005deec ca6cd52b ca6cd52b 00000000 00000000 00000001 00000001 00000000 00000000 cab7cd7c cab7cd7c

[ 6.913171] cac4493e
[ 6.913171] cac4493e d5a87f88 d5a87f88 c005df00 c005df00 ca590d75 ca590d75 ca5d25fd ca5d25fd ffffff9f ffffff9f ffffff9f ffffff9f c005df0c c005df0c

[ 6.918206] cac4499f
[ 6.918206] cac4499f caad4600 caad4600 c005df84 c005df84 c9c00442 c9c00442 024000c0 024000c0 ca9b99ac ca9b99ac cac4493e cac4493e 00000068 00000068

[ 6.921476] Call Trace:
[ 6.921476] Call Trace:
[ 6.922000] [<ca6cd52b>] ? _raw_spin_lock_bh+0x6b/0x80
[ 6.922000] [<ca6cd52b>] ? _raw_spin_lock_bh+0x6b/0x80
[ 6.924344] [<cac4493e>] ? dccp_v6_init_net+0x30/0x30
[ 6.924344] [<cac4493e>] ? dccp_v6_init_net+0x30/0x30
[ 6.925606] [<ca590d75>] inet6_unregister_protosw+0x25/0x60
[ 6.925606] [<ca590d75>] inet6_unregister_protosw+0x25/0x60
[ 6.930274] [<ca5d25fd>] ? inet6_del_protocol+0x2d/0x40
[ 6.930274] [<ca5d25fd>] ? inet6_del_protocol+0x2d/0x40
[ 6.931517] [<cac4499f>] dccp_v6_init+0x61/0x70
[ 6.931517] [<cac4499f>] dccp_v6_init+0x61/0x70
[ 6.932670] [<c9c00442>] do_one_initcall+0x82/0x1e0
[ 6.932670] [<c9c00442>] do_one_initcall+0x82/0x1e0
[ 6.937242] [<cac4493e>] ? dccp_v6_init_net+0x30/0x30
[ 6.937242] [<cac4493e>] ? dccp_v6_init_net+0x30/0x30
[ 6.939877] [<c9c77546>] ? parse_args+0x176/0x440
[ 6.939877] [<c9c77546>] ? parse_args+0x176/0x440
[ 6.940919] [<cabf3c59>] ? kernel_init_freeable+0xcd/0x16a
[ 6.940919] [<cabf3c59>] ? kernel_init_freeable+0xcd/0x16a
[ 6.942284] [<cabf3c79>] kernel_init_freeable+0xed/0x16a
[ 6.942284] [<cabf3c79>] kernel_init_freeable+0xed/0x16a
[ 6.946965] [<ca6c42b0>] kernel_init+0x10/0xe0
[ 6.946965] [<ca6c42b0>] kernel_init+0x10/0xe0
[ 6.948084] [<ca6ce169>] ret_from_kernel_thread+0x21/0x38
[ 6.948084] [<ca6ce169>] ret_from_kernel_thread+0x21/0x38
[ 6.952443] [<ca6c42a0>] ? rest_init+0xc0/0xc0
[ 6.952443] [<ca6c42a0>] ? rest_init+0xc0/0xc0
[ 6.953426] Code:
[ 6.953426] Code: 78 78 69 69 bc bc ca ca 89 89 f2 f2 e8 e8 c8 c8 11 11 bb bb ff ff 81 81 7d 7d f0 f0 00 00 02 02 00 00 00 00 0f 0f 84 84 6b 6b 01 01 00 00 00 00 31 31 c9 c9 89 89 f2 f2 b8 b8 64 64 69 69 bc bc ca ca e8 e8 ad ad 11 11 bb bb ff ff 8b 8b 45 45 f0 f0 31 31 d2 d2 <8b> <8b> 30 30 b8 b8 50 50 69 69 bc bc ca ca 39 39 f3 f3 0f 0f 95 95 c2 c2 31 31 c9 c9 89 89 55 55 ec ec e8 e8 92 92 11 11 bb bb

[ 6.965056] EIP: [<ca1779b8>]
[ 6.965056] EIP: [<ca1779b8>] __list_del_entry+0x88/0x230__list_del_entry+0x88/0x230 SS:ESP 0068:c005dec4
SS:ESP 0068:c005dec4
[ 6.970187] CR2: 0000000000000000
[ 6.970187] CR2: 0000000000000000
[ 6.970894] ---[ end trace 2c9f823fcf08155b ]---
[ 6.970894] ---[ end trace 2c9f823fcf08155b ]---





Thanks,
Kernel Test Robot


Attachments:
(No filename) (5.08 kB)
config-4.4.0-rc3-00302-gc5e8d79 (105.55 kB)
dmesg.xz (11.48 kB)
Download all attachments